后端服务器端大不同,场景化解析协作关系,后端协作解析,服务器端差异与场景化应用
(凌晨三点,创业公司CTO老张盯着崩溃的支付系统怒吼:"服务器端明明正常,怎么后端业务全挂了?!"——这个经典场景正好揭示了两者的本质差异。今天咱们就掰开揉碎说清楚。)
一、餐厅剧场理论:最直白的区分法
想象你走进餐厅:
- 服务器端 = 整个餐厅空间(厨房设备+水电系统+桌椅)
→ 负责基础运行保障 - 后端 = 厨师和服务员团队
→ 处理点餐/烹饪/上菜等业务流程
突发状况验证:
▶ 空调坏了(服务器端故障)→ 所有食客热得离场
▶ 厨师 *** (后端瘫痪)→ 满座客人吃不上饭
去年双十一某电商翻车事件:服务器承载量充足(没崩),但优惠计算逻辑出错(后端bug)导致亏损千万
二、技术视角对照表:别再傻傻分不清
维度 | 服务器端 | 后端 |
---|---|---|
核心任务 | 硬件资源调度/网络通信 | 业务逻辑实现/数据处理 |
故障表现 | 网站彻底打不开 | 功能异常但能访问界面 |
典型岗位 | 运维工程师/DevOps | Java/Python开发工程师 |
日常操作 | 扩容CPU/配置防火墙 | 写订单模块/调支付接口 |
紧急修复 | 重启服务器/增加带宽 | 修改代码逻辑/回滚版本 |
(上周亲眼见运维小哥给服务器加了内存,结果后端代码内存泄漏照崩不误——就像给餐厅换新灶台,但厨师还是烧糊菜)
三、协作场景全透视:1+1>2的实战密码
▍场景1:用户下单失败
- 服务器端排查:
检查API网关是否过载 ✔️
验证数据库连接数是否爆满 ✔️ - 后端排查:
查看订单创建逻辑是否 *** 锁 ✘
分析优惠券计算是否超时 ✘
▍场景2:凌晨数据同步卡 ***
- 服务器端方案:增加NAS存储带宽
- 后端方案:优化SQL查询+加缓存机制
真实案例:某银行系统升级时,两边团队同时:
✓ 服务器端升级SSD硬盘(吞吐量+200%)
✓ 后端重构分库分表(查询速度+500%)
最终性能提升10倍
四、选型避坑指南:烧钱教训总结
*** 亡组合1:强服务器端+弱后端
→ 好比用超级计算机跑计算器程序(资源浪费80%)
*** 亡组合2:强后端+破服务器
→ 顶级厨师在漏雨的棚屋做饭(再牛也发挥不出)
黄金配置公式:
复制业务复杂度 x 3 = 后端投入用户规模 x 2 = 服务器端投入
(参考某日活百万APP架构:20人后端团队+8人精英运维)
(看着监控屏上跳动的服务器指标与后端日志流,突然想起导师那句话:"服务器端是舞台,后端是演员——没有好舞台演不了大戏,没有好演员撑不起票房"。你的技术团队,准备好这场协作了么?)